PCI Health Training Center vs. VGI

Both PCI Health Training Center and Valley Grande Institute for Academic Studies are Less than 2 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are PCI Health Training Center and Valley Grande Institute for Academic Studies with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• VGI's tuition ($24,451) is more expensive than PCI Health Training Center ($15,222).
  • VGI's students to faculty ratio (12 to 1) is lower than PCI Health Training Center (35 to 1).
  • PCI Health Training Center (282 students) is larger than VGI (229 students) with more enrolled students.
  • VGI ($6,892) has higher amount of financial aid than PCI Health Training Center ($5,898).
